What anatomical components are responsible for the tiger's ability to produce a deep, far-reaching roar?

Answer

A flexible hyoid apparatus and a vocal fold equipped with a thick fibro-elastic pad

The ability to produce a loud, far-reaching roar is attributed to the combination of a flexible hyoid apparatus and a vocal fold that includes a thick fibro-elastic pad.
